## Authentication

The Drossel telemetry agent compresses payloads with zstd before shipping to the Halvane ingest service. Auth is a single static key per environment; the ingest endpoint rejects uncompressed bodies over 1 MB regardless of auth. Do not reuse prod credentials in the sandbox. Config lives in agent.toml under [ingest]. For local testing against the sandbox ingest, use the key directly below.

API key for yahig-tadup: kto7_ubizbYm

Hi, and welcome aboard. You're covering the Emberpoints loyalty ledger this rotation. The ledger is append-only; never edit balances directly — post a compensating entry instead, and always note the reason code. Reconciliation runs hourly and pages on drift over 0.1%. The full on-call guide for the ledger is here.

runbook for badug-kadup: https://confluence.zemvarlabs.internal/projects/browse/display/projects/bd1b

Key ceremony checklist — step 7 (Greave Telemetry Gateway). Confirm both custodians are present before opening the signing laptop. Verify the firmware bundle for the field gateways matches the hash on the ceremony sheet. As the new contractor, you act as witness only; do not touch the token. Once the quorum signs, the backup shard is re-sealed using the passphrase written immediately below.

strongbox words: zoreth-fraox-oliius-aldeth-jorax-praeth-holmir-drumir-prawyn

## Onboarding: Sensor Drift in the Verdanta Greenhouse Controller

The Verdanta controller recalibrates humidity and temperature sensors nightly to correct drift. If drift exceeds tolerance, the controller isolates the affected zone and enters safe mode, which disables remote management. Recovering from safe mode requires physical confirmation at the cabinet plus the maintenance recovery passphrase. For review purposes, the current passphrase is recorded below.

strongbox words: eliius-pelath-sorius-oliys-noviel